A Pleasant Culinary Surprise in Fairbanks, Alaska

A Pleasant Culinary Surprise in Fairbanks, Alaska: Chowder House After spending a few days in Fairbanks, I still hadn’t found a chance to enjoy a proper seafood meal. Finally, after enduring continuous cold spells and snow, I decided to treat myself to this restaurant ❄️🦀. For the first time, I tried a crab roll made with whole crab leg meat—two pieces per order. The crab meat was generous, with a fresh and light flavor that wasn’t greasy at all. The garlic shrimp was also a delightful surprise—rich in garlic aroma without overpowering the taste. My boyfriend and I ended up dipping all the accompanying bread into the sauce and finishing every last bit 🍞. The smoked salmon soup was truly comforting. After drinking it, I felt completely warmed up—perfect for such chilly weather. The king crab was priced at market rate, so we skipped it as it was a bit expensive. We plan to buy some later at Costco and have it prepared at a Chinese restaurant instead—much more cost-effective, haha 😄. The restaurant has its own parking lot, making it very convenient. We arrived around 4:30 PM and were seated right away without any wait. The kitchen seemed to prepare dishes table by table in order, unlike some places that prioritize takeout orders first, which made for a great dining experience. The servers were also very friendly, making us feel comfortable and welcome. In the cold of Fairbanks, a warm and satisfying dinner like this is truly what one needs 🥹.
